Pruning Techniques Clarified
Pruning plays an essential role in maintaining the health and aesthetics of trees. Multiple techniques are available, each serving specific purposes. The thinning method involves selectively removing branches to enhance light penetration and air circulation, promoting overall tree vigor. In contrast, the heading method emphasizes shaping the tree by cutting back branches to a predetermined point, encouraging denser foliage. Reduction pruning, which shortens branches to decrease size while retaining the tree's natural form, is valuable for managing growth. Finally, rejuvenation pruning is applied on overgrown trees, significantly cutting back branches to stimulate new growth. Comprehending these techniques empowers property owners to enhance their landscape while ensuring the longevity and beauty of their trees.

Symptoms and Identification
Detecting symptoms of tree diseases is a crucial step for tree owners working to sustain the health and longevity of their trees. Common indicators include off-colored leaves, which may exhibit yellowing, browning, or spots, often suggesting underlying issues. Wilting or drooping branches can signal water stress or disease. Additionally, unusual growths such as galls, cankers, or fungal fruiting bodies may point to specific infections. A noticeable increase in insect activity can also be evidence of tree distress. Overall, changes in bark texture or color, together with premature leaf drop, are vital symptoms to monitor. Early identification of these signs enables owners to seek suitable guidance, ensuring trees receive timely care before conditions worsen.

What Is the Proper Watering Schedule for Newly Planted Trees?
Newly planted trees should be watered deeply once a week during dry spells. In their first growing season, consistent moisture is essential. Checking the soil's moisture content will indicate whether extra watering is needed.
Is It Possible for Tree Roots to Damage My Foundation?
Yes, tree roots can compromise foundations. As they develop, roots may exert force on the soil and nearby structures, which can causing cracks or shifting. Proper tree placement and regular inspections can help minimize these risks.
What Symptoms Indicate a Dying Tree?
Signs of a dying tree include discolored or wilting leaves, significant leaf fall, dead branches, fungal growth, and fissures in the bark. Furthermore, a significant lean or soft spots in the trunk may signal poor health.
Do Certain Trees Work Better in Small Yards?
Particular trees, like Japanese maples, dogwoods, and dwarf varieties, are excellent for small yards. They bring beauty without overwhelming confined space, offering shade and beauty while maintaining practical growth and care requirements.
